Updated: SBHS graduate killed in wreck; driver accused of DUI

A 2006 graduate of San Benito High School died in a single-car accident early Friday morning on Union Road, and the California Highway Patrol arrested the 19-year-old driver on suspicion of driving under the influence and gross vehicular manslaughter.

Council approves adult-use cannabis

The Hollister City Council unanimously voted Monday night to allow recreational cannabis cultivation, manufacturing, distribution, and testing businesses to operate within city limits. Recreational, or adult-use, dispensaries and retail sales are still prohibited, but medical cannabis will be available from two dispensaries—Purple Cross Rx...
